Output ec3617d1d13a8914e384e1f9f35d1fe3780c8769ef708432d4ce50c7c7b03200:3

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07d93acd649fce2673f726ef5bee2fad4e56eba OP_EQUAL
address
3LhQugF2ukc3AnRv39vY8ztfTVNLPSqK7W
transaction
ec3617d1d13a8914e384e1f9f35d1fe3780c8769ef708432d4ce50c7c7b03200
spent
true